| import baseUpdate from './_baseUpdate.js';
 | |
| import castFunction from './_castFunction.js';
 | |
| 
 | |
| /**
 | |
|  * This method is like `_.set` except that accepts `updater` to produce the
 | |
|  * value to set. Use `_.updateWith` to customize `path` creation. The `updater`
 | |
|  * is invoked with one argument: (value).
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  * **Note:** This method mutates `object`.
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  * @static
 | |
|  * @memberOf _
 | |
|  * @since 4.6.0
 | |
|  * @category Object
 | |
|  * @param {Object} object The object to modify.
 | |
|  * @param {Array|string} path The path of the property to set.
 | |
|  * @param {Function} updater The function to produce the updated value.
 | |
|  * @returns {Object} Returns `object`.
 | |
|  * @example
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  * var object = { 'a': [{ 'b': { 'c': 3 } }] };
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  * _.update(object, 'a[0].b.c', function(n) { return n * n; });
 | |
|  * console.log(object.a[0].b.c);
 | |
|  * // => 9
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  * _.update(object, 'x[0].y.z', function(n) { return n ? n + 1 : 0; });
 | |
|  * console.log(object.x[0].y.z);
 | |
|  * // => 0
 | |
|  */
 | |
| function update(object, path, updater) {
 | |
|   return object == null ? object : baseUpdate(object, path, castFunction(updater));
 | |
| }
 | |
| 
 | |
| export default update;
